0
  • 聊天消息
  • 系統(tǒng)消息
  • 評論與回復(fù)
登錄后你可以
  • 下載海量資料
  • 學(xué)習(xí)在線課程
  • 觀看技術(shù)視頻
  • 寫文章/發(fā)帖/加入社區(qū)
會員中心
創(chuàng)作中心

完善資料讓更多小伙伴認(rèn)識你,還能領(lǐng)取20積分哦,立即完善>

3天內(nèi)不再提示

如何在TigerGraph的圖查詢語言GSQL中支持 openCypher

TigerGraph ? 來源:TigerGraph ? 作者:TigerGraph ? 2022-10-20 14:30 ? 次閱讀

TigerGraph即將正式支持 openCypher,這是一種用于構(gòu)建圖數(shù)據(jù)庫應(yīng)用程序的流行查詢語言。開發(fā)人員現(xiàn)在可以訪問預(yù)覽工具,以了解如何在 TigerGraph 的圖查詢語言 GSQL 中支持 openCypher。對 openCypher 的支持將為開發(fā)人員提供更多選擇來構(gòu)建或遷移圖應(yīng)用程序到 TigerGraph 的可擴(kuò)展、安全和完全托管的圖數(shù)據(jù)庫平臺。

“TigerGraph 的使命一直是將圖的力量帶給所有人,我們對 openCypher 的支持幫助我們做到了這一點(diǎn)。我們正在通過我們的高級圖分析和機(jī)器學(xué)習(xí)平臺幫助企業(yè)加速采用圖技術(shù),”TigerGraph 首席執(zhí)行官兼創(chuàng)始人許昱博士說。 “借助 openCypher 支持,我們正在推動圖創(chuàng)新,并為開發(fā)人員提供另一種方式來采用和擴(kuò)展他們對圖的使用,從而在他們的數(shù)據(jù)中找到具有競爭力的洞察力?!?/p>

熟悉 openCypher 的開發(fā)人員現(xiàn)在可以學(xué)習(xí)如何利用 TigerGraph 的強(qiáng)大功能為數(shù)據(jù)庫內(nèi)計算和數(shù)據(jù)關(guān)系分析實(shí)現(xiàn)卓越的性能和可擴(kuò)展性。通過使用 TigerGraph 復(fù)雜的 GSQL 語言,開發(fā)人員將體驗(yàn)到多種好處,包括:

更具表達(dá)力:高級、強(qiáng)大的查詢涵蓋高級圖算法,包括 TigerGraph 的數(shù)據(jù)科學(xué)庫中可用 GSQL 編碼的 55 多種算法

更強(qiáng)性能:通過輕松優(yōu)化,查詢以更快的速度運(yùn)行,以利用底層引擎的內(nèi)置并行處理能力

例如,PageRank 是一種流行的圖算法,用于根據(jù)不同頁面相互引用的方式計算網(wǎng)頁的相對重要性。不管數(shù)據(jù)的大小如何,PageRank 算法只需要 10 行 GSQL 代碼就可以進(jìn)行編碼,而 openCypher 只能編碼該算法的一部分。

現(xiàn)在 openCypher 開發(fā)者社區(qū)可以使用openCypher 到 GSQL 的翻譯工具,以訪問等效 openCypher 查詢的GSQL 查詢建議,并可以與 openCypher 語法進(jìn)行并排比較。通過這個有限的預(yù)覽版,我們鼓勵開發(fā)人員了解 openCypher 將如何出現(xiàn)在 GSQL 中,并提供有價值的反饋來指導(dǎo)我們逐步建立完整的支持功能。想要學(xué)習(xí)高級 GSQL 的人現(xiàn)在可以訪問 TigerGraph 的產(chǎn)品,包括其分布式計算數(shù)據(jù)庫、數(shù)據(jù)庫內(nèi)機(jī)器學(xué)習(xí)工作臺和圖數(shù)據(jù)科學(xué)庫,其中包含超過 55 種圖算法。

此外,作為ISO 指導(dǎo)委員會成員,TigerGraph 的 openCypher 支持與對行業(yè)標(biāo)準(zhǔn) GQL 的支持保持一致。該委員會正在開發(fā) 一種新的國際標(biāo)準(zhǔn)查詢語言GQL,將于2024年初推出。

審核編輯:彭靜
聲明:本文內(nèi)容及配圖由入駐作者撰寫或者入駐合作網(wǎng)站授權(quán)轉(zhuǎn)載。文章觀點(diǎn)僅代表作者本人,不代表電子發(fā)燒友網(wǎng)立場。文章及其配圖僅供工程師學(xué)習(xí)之用,如有內(nèi)容侵權(quán)或者其他違規(guī)問題,請聯(lián)系本站處理。 舉報投訴
  • 數(shù)據(jù)庫
    +關(guān)注

    關(guān)注

    7

    文章

    3822

    瀏覽量

    64506
  • pgsql
    +關(guān)注

    關(guān)注

    0

    文章

    3

    瀏覽量

    1549

原文標(biāo)題:TigerGraph 宣布即將正式在 GSQL 中支持 openCypher

文章出處:【微信號:TigerGraph,微信公眾號:TigerGraph】歡迎添加關(guān)注!文章轉(zhuǎn)載請注明出處。

收藏 人收藏

    評論

    相關(guān)推薦

    gitee 支持的編程語言有哪些

    Gitee(碼云)是一個基于 Git 的代碼托管和研發(fā)協(xié)作平臺,類似于 GitHub 和 GitLab。它支持多種編程語言,允許開發(fā)者托管和管理代碼,進(jìn)行版本控制,以及協(xié)作開發(fā)。以下是一些
    的頭像 發(fā)表于 01-06 09:50 ?69次閱讀

    Triton編譯器支持的編程語言

    Triton編譯器支持的編程語言主要包括以下幾種: 一、主要編程語言 Python :Triton編譯器通過Python接口提供了對Triton語言和編譯器的訪問,使得用戶可以在Pyt
    的頭像 發(fā)表于 12-24 17:33 ?375次閱讀

    語言模型開發(fā)語言是什么

    在人工智能領(lǐng)域,大語言模型(Large Language Models, LLMs)背后,離不開高效的開發(fā)語言和工具的支持。下面,AI部落小編為您介紹大語言模型開發(fā)所依賴的主要編程
    的頭像 發(fā)表于 12-04 11:44 ?144次閱讀

    NPU支持的編程語言有哪些

    NPU(Neural Processing Unit)是一種專門為深度學(xué)習(xí)和人工智能應(yīng)用設(shè)計的處理器。NPU支持的編程語言通常與它所集成的平臺或框架緊密相關(guān)。以下是一些常見的編程語言和框架,它們可以
    的頭像 發(fā)表于 11-15 09:21 ?748次閱讀

    串口屏支持哪些編程語言和開發(fā)環(huán)境?

    串口屏作為一種常用的顯示和交互設(shè)備,支持多種編程語言和開發(fā)環(huán)境。以下是對串口屏支持的編程語言和開發(fā)環(huán)境的詳細(xì)歸納:
    的頭像 發(fā)表于 11-13 11:45 ?256次閱讀
    串口屏<b class='flag-5'>支持</b>哪些編程<b class='flag-5'>語言</b>和開發(fā)環(huán)境?

    Orin芯片的編程語言支持

    Orin是一款高度集成、高性能的車載計算平臺,由英偉達(dá)推出,并采用了英偉達(dá)自家的Volta架構(gòu)GPU和其他高級處理器技術(shù)。關(guān)于Orin芯片的編程語言支持,可以從以下幾個方面進(jìn)行介紹: 一、主要編程
    的頭像 發(fā)表于 10-27 16:45 ?321次閱讀

    ChatGPT 的多語言支持特點(diǎn)

    )技術(shù)迎來了巨大的挑戰(zhàn)和機(jī)遇。ChatGPT,作為一個領(lǐng)先的語言模型,其多語言支持的特點(diǎn)成為了它在眾多應(yīng)用場景中不可或缺的優(yōu)勢。 1. 多語言理解能力 ChatGPT 的多語言支持首先
    的頭像 發(fā)表于 10-25 17:30 ?815次閱讀

    超聲應(yīng)用中支持多個AFE高輸出電流的精密求和電路

    電子發(fā)燒友網(wǎng)站提供《超聲應(yīng)用中支持多個AFE高輸出電流的精密求和電路.pdf》資料免費(fèi)下載
    發(fā)表于 10-25 09:21 ?0次下載
    超聲應(yīng)用<b class='flag-5'>中支持</b>多個AFE高輸出電流的精密求和電路

    鴻蒙語言基礎(chǔ)類庫:system.mediaquery 媒體查詢

    根據(jù)媒體查詢條件,創(chuàng)建MediaQueryList對象。
    的頭像 發(fā)表于 07-17 16:50 ?321次閱讀
    鴻蒙<b class='flag-5'>語言</b>基礎(chǔ)類庫:system.mediaquery  媒體<b class='flag-5'>查詢</b>

    革命性的圖形分析: NVIDIA cuGraph 加速的下一代架構(gòu)

    的發(fā)展 在我們早期涉足圖形分析的過程中,我們在使用的架構(gòu)方面面臨著各種挑戰(zhàn)。這種體系結(jié)構(gòu)雖然有效,但也造成了阻礙設(shè)置和性能的障礙。 1.(以前的體系結(jié)構(gòu))使用 TigerGraph、cuGraph 和 GSQL 進(jìn)行高性能圖
    的頭像 發(fā)表于 06-04 17:54 ?7592次閱讀
    革命性的圖形分析: NVIDIA cuGraph 加速的下一代架構(gòu)

    鴻蒙開發(fā)接口公共事件與通知:【FFI能力】 N-API在Android、iOS平臺應(yīng)用的使用指導(dǎo)

    N-API接口可以實(shí)現(xiàn)ArkTS/TS/JS與C/C++(Native)之間的交互,ArkUI-X中支持的N-API接口情況和使用場景請見[FFI能力(N-API)]。本文檔以[ArkUI-X/Samples]中的Native樣例工程為例,介紹如何在Android平臺上使
    的頭像 發(fā)表于 05-25 16:33 ?1956次閱讀
    鴻蒙開發(fā)接口公共事件與通知:【FFI能力】 N-API在Android、iOS平臺應(yīng)用的使用指導(dǎo)

    iOS版ChatGPT支持首選語言設(shè)置中文

    近日,iOS版ChatGPT迎來了1.2024.129版本的重要更新。此次更新最顯著的變化是新增了對App首選語言設(shè)置中文的支持,打破了之前僅限于其他語言的限制。
    的頭像 發(fā)表于 05-17 09:31 ?634次閱讀

    三星Galaxy AI將支持19種語言,覆蓋粵語及法語等

     截止當(dāng)前,三星Galaxy AI共支持13個語言,此舉將讓全球更多三星用戶享受到該產(chǎn)品的便利。此外,三星計劃至今年底再增加對羅馬尼亞語、土耳其語等8種語言支持
    的頭像 發(fā)表于 04-15 15:56 ?1024次閱讀

    ELF技術(shù)貼|如何在開發(fā)板上實(shí)現(xiàn)對Java的支持

    Java作為一種功能強(qiáng)大且廣泛應(yīng)用的編程語言,具有廣泛的適應(yīng)性和實(shí)用性。在ELF1開發(fā)板上集成Java支持,無疑將賦予嵌入式開發(fā)者更廣闊的選擇空間,今天就為各位小伙伴詳細(xì)解析如何在ELF1開發(fā)板上成
    的頭像 發(fā)表于 03-13 16:47 ?523次閱讀
    ELF技術(shù)貼|如<b class='flag-5'>何在</b>開發(fā)板上實(shí)現(xiàn)對Java的<b class='flag-5'>支持</b>

    何在stm32cubemx中精確查詢

    stm32cubemx中finder功能的確很方便,但我遇到一個問題 現(xiàn)在片子上pin復(fù)用功能越來越多,越來越方便 我同時需要多個接口,如,1個can,2個spi,1個csi...... 選擇時,會出現(xiàn)數(shù)量上滿足了,但不少pin是復(fù)用,不能共存。 請教如何在cubemx中能精確
    發(fā)表于 03-12 06:11